#' Outputting HTML tables in RStudio viewer/R Notebooks
#'
#' This is method for rendering results of \link{fre}/\link{cro}/\link{tables}
#' in Shiny/RMarkdown/Jupyter notebooks and etc. For detailed description of
#' function and its arguments see \link[htmlTable]{htmlTable}. You can pack your
#' tables in the list and render them all simultaneously. See examples. You may
#' be interested in \code{expss_output_viewer()} for automatical rendering
#' tables in the RStudio viewer or \code{expss_output_rnotebook()} for
#' rendering in the R notebooks. See \link{expss.options}. \code{repr_html} is
#' method for rendering table in the Jupyter notebooks and \code{knit_print} is
#' method for rendering table in the \code{knitr} HTML-documents. Jupyter
#' notebooks and \code{knitr} documents are supported automatically but in the R
#' notebooks it is needed to set output to notebook via
#' \code{expss_output_rnotebook()}.
#'
#' @param x a data object of class 'etable' - result of \link{fre}/\link{cro} and etc.
#' @param obj a data object of class 'etable' - result of \link{fre}/\link{cro} and etc.
#' @param digits integer By default, all numeric columns are rounded to one digit after
#' decimal separator. Also you can set this argument by setting option 'expss.digits'
#' - for example, \code{expss_digits(2)}. If it is NA than all
#' numeric columns remain unrounded.
#' @param escape.html logical: should HTML characters be escaped? Defaults to FALSE.
#' @param ... further parameters for \link[htmlTable]{htmlTable}.
#' @param row_groups logical Should we create row groups? TRUE by default.
#' @param gap character Separator between tables if we output list of
#' tables. By default it is line break '<br>'.
#' @param header Ignored.
#' @param rnames Ignored.
#' @param rowlabel Ignored.
#' @param caption See manual for \link[htmlTable]{htmlTable}.
#' @param tfoot See manual for \link[htmlTable]{htmlTable}.
#' @param label See manual for \link[htmlTable]{htmlTable}.
#' @param rgroup Ignored.
#' @param n.rgroup Ignored.
#' @param cgroup Ignored.
#' @param n.cgroup Ignored.
#' @param tspanner See manual for \link[htmlTable]{htmlTable}.
#' @param n.tspanner See manual for \link[htmlTable]{htmlTable}.
#' @param total See manual for \link[htmlTable]{htmlTable}.
#' @param ctable See manual for \link[htmlTable]{htmlTable}.
#' @param compatibility See manual for \link[htmlTable]{htmlTable}.
#' @param cspan.rgroup See manual for \link[htmlTable]{htmlTable}.
#' @return Returns a string of class htmlTable
